Many refer to Winter Park and the Fraser Valley as “Mountain Bike Capital, USA.” You’ll find some 600 miles of multi-use trails spread across the valley through peaceful meadows, past rushing streams and up rugged mountainsides. Most of the trails take advantage of the area’s bounty of public lands, including the Arapaho National Forest, Rocky Mountain National Park and BLM lands. You will find top-to-bottom mountain biking for all levels at
the Winter Park Resort base area. Cyclists, and their bikes, are
transported to the summit of Winter Park mountain via the Zephyr
Express chairlift. From there, riders have access to the resort's
50-mile network of interconnected trails.
